WebMar 4, 2024 · The La Jolla seal colony consists primarily of California sea lions and harbor seals. The harbor seals tend to be smaller than the sea lions and they have mottled silver-gray fur and a white underside. They are known for their low grunting noises that are different from the barks of the sea lions.

It's so cool to walk alongside the beach and see the seals! … WebCasa Beach in La Jolla is the only NOAA-recognized mainland harbor seal rookery between the U.S./Mexico Border and Ventura County, 160 miles to the north. It is very rare for harbor seals to choose an urbanized setting for their home.
